> On Fri, Feb 23, 2018 at 09:41:27AM +0000, PG Doc comments form wrote:
> > According to the documentation, I assume normal users will be able to
> view
> > pg_hba_file_rules once they are granted select privileges. But for the
> > privileged user it's giving following error while trying to view records:
> >
> > ERROR: permission denied for function pg_hba_file_rules
> > SQL state: 42501
>
> I think that you need as well execution rights on pg_hba_file_rules() to
> give access to it.
